
Dragon Melting a Town Hueforge
Molten flames cascade through this dramatic scene as a dragon's fiery breath engulfs an unfortunate settlement below. The composition explodes with intense yellows and oranges at the center, radiating outward through deep crimsons and burgundies before dissolving into charcoal shadows. Textured layers create the illusion of flowing lava and billowing smoke, while the warm palette perfectly captures the devastating heat of draconic destruction in vivid, three-dimensional detail.
